The state of agentic payments in 2026
x402, AP2, and AgentKit made agent-to-agent payments real. The rails are live; the control layer is the constraint. Here's where the stack stands and what ships next.
Agentic payments — payments initiated by an AI agent rather than a human — moved from prototype to production this year. Three rails define the stack: x402 (HTTP-based, using the 402 status code), Google's AP2, and Coinbase AgentKit for onchain payments. Each lets an agent discover a payable resource and settle it autonomously.
What's real
All three rails are live and shipping products. The pattern is consistent: an agent requests a resource, the rail presents payment terms, the agent settles, and the resource unlocks. Settlement is fast — seconds, not days — which is exactly why the next layer matters.
What's missing
Rails move money; none of them screen transactions before settlement. A runaway agent on a fast rail is damage at settlement speed — the incident database already contains the shapes this takes. The control layer — a deterministic pre-spend decision in front of the rail — is where the stack is immature, and where the firewall pattern fits.
